SENIOR LECTURER / LECTURER IN ART HISTORY
Department of Art History
Faculty of Arts
University of Auckland, New Zealand

Vacancy 1273

The Department of Art History is seeking either a Senior Lecturer or a
Lecturer to fill a recent vacancy in the area of Italian Renaissance art and
Baroque art in Europe. As there is no permanent departmental appointment in
Contemporary Art and Theory, applicants with expertise in these areas would
also be considered.

The successful candidate would have a PhD, a strong record of research and
publication, and teaching experience in his/her area. Some experience in
administration would also be a recommendation.

The post could be filled from the beginning of the second semester, July
2001, or from the beginning of the new academic year in 2002, depending on
the successful candidates commitments.
